Dear Blessed Lord Jesus, good morning. I love you and thank you for this new day. Father God, today I pray for our spiritual growth. I ask that you instill in us the desire to read and memorize your word. Give us a passion to be in constant conversation with you. May loving you and serving you be part of our daily life. I ask that you stay close to us and lead us to be transformed to your likeness, to reflect your grace, uniqueness and to radiate your love. Thank you, praise and give you all the honor and glory Lord Jesus. Amen.
——————————————————-
The LORD is good, a strong hold in the day of trouble; and he knoweth them that trust in him. But with an overrunning flood he will make an utter end of the place thereof, and darkness shall pursue his enemies. What do ye imagine against the LORD? he will make an utter end: affliction shall not rise up the second time. Nahum 1:7-9

“So that you may become blameless and pure, children of God without fault in a warped and crooked generation. Then you will shine among them like stars in the sky.” Philippians 2:15 (NIV)

Loving Father God, Thank You and praise You for the gift of this day. As I walk through it, may I be a light in someone’s darkness, a smile in someone’s sorrow, and a reminder of Your love in someone’s loneliness. Help me to make a difference, not through grand gestures, but through simple acts of kindness, compassion, and grace. Let my words bring peace, my actions reflect Your joy, and my heart remain open to those You place in my path. May I live with intention, love without condition, and serve with gladness. Love You, thank You, praise You and give You all the honor and glory in Jesus Precious name, Amen and Amen.

“Guilt”
God is patient with his repentant children but will punish the guilty.
———–
The LORD is slow to anger, and great in power, and will not at all acquit {clear a person of a charge of wrongdoing} the wicked: the LORD hath his way in the whirlwind and in the storm, and the clouds are the dust of his feet. Nahum 1:3
————
“Forgiveness”
Trust God to take care of you! Not a straggler {One who rambles without any settled direction}.
————
For I will be merciful to their unrighteousness, and their sins and their iniquities will I remember no more.

Hebrews 8:12

O Righteous and Merciful Father God, You are slow to anger and great in power. Your justice is perfect, and Your holiness cannot be compromised. Yet in Your mercy, You reach out to the brokenhearted, to the repentant, to those who have wandered and now return. Thank You and praise You, for not acquitting the wicked, but for offering forgiveness to those who seek You. Thank You for remembering our sins no more, for covering our iniquities with the blood of Jesus. Help us to trust You, not as stragglers without direction, but as children led by Your Spirit. Let us walk humbly, knowing that guilt is not our end when grace is our invitation. May we live in the freedom of Your forgiveness and extend that same mercy to others. Love You, thank You, praise You and give You all the honor and Glory in Jesus’ Precious name, Amen.

We learn to love people in spite of all their weaknesses and our own weaknesses, only then will life take on a whole new level of excitement. When we pray for others, we give them the love of the Lord and encourage them to live a life in line with His guidance.

Gracious Father God, teach me to love as You love, without condition, without judgment. Help me to see others through Your eyes, not defined by their weaknesses or mine, but by the beauty of who You created them to be. Let my heart be tender, my words kind, and my prayers full of hope. When I lift others up in prayer, let it be an offering of Your love. May my intercession be a light in their darkness, a reminder of Your guidance, and a seed of encouragement in their journey. Use me, Lord, to reflect Your mercy and truth. Thank You and praise You for loving me in my brokenness. Help me to extend that same love to those around me, so that life may overflow with the joy of Your presence. Love You, thank You, praise You and give You all the Honor and glory in Jesus Precious Name Amen and Amen.

“Above all, love each other deeply, because love covers over a multitude of sins.”

1 Peter 4:8 (NIV)

“When you have learned how to decide with God, all decisions become as easy and as right as breathing! There is no effort, and you will be led as gently as if you were being carried down a quiet path in awe. Leave all decisions to The One {Holy Spirit} Who speaks for God, and for your function as He knows it. God’s actions speak truth and His word is undeniable. His love is everlasting.”

“For as many as are led by the Spirit of God, they are the sons of God.” Romans 8:14 (KJV)

Holy Spirit, Divine Counselor, teach me to decide with You. Let my choices be rooted not in fear or confusion, but in the quiet confidence of Your presence. May every decision flow as naturally as breath, guided by Your wisdom and filled with Your peace. I surrender my plans, my questions, and my uncertainties to You. Lead me down the quiet path of awe, where Your truth speaks louder than my doubts. Remind me that Your love is everlasting, Your word unshakable, and Your purpose for me sure. Help me to listen, to trust, and to follow, knowing that in You, I will never be lost. Love You, thank You, praise You and give You all the honor and glory in Jesus Precious Name Amen and Amen.

“Seek and Find The Peace Of God”

In peace I was created. And in peace do I remain. It is not given me to change my Self. How merciful is God my Father, that when He created me He gave me peace forever. Now I ask but to be what I am. And can this be denied me, when it is forever true.

John 14:27 (KJV)

“Peace I leave with you, my peace I give unto you: not as the world giveth, give I unto you. Let not your heart be troubled, neither let it be afraid.”

Heavenly Father God, You are the Author of peace and the Keeper of my soul. In You I was created, and in Your peace I remain. Let me not be swayed by the noise of the world or the illusions that seek to redefine me. I ask only to be what You made me to be, whole, beloved, and forever Yours. Thank You and praise You for the mercy that surrounds me, for the truth that cannot be undone, and for the peace that passes all understanding. Help me to rest in this truth today. Let Your Spirit quiet my heart and remind me that I am held in Your eternal love. May I seek and find Your peace, not in striving, but in surrender. Not in changing, but in remembering. Love You, thank You, praise You and give You all the honor and glory in Jesus Precious Name Amen and Amen.

Then Jesus six days before the passover came to Bethany, where Lazarus was, which had been dead, whom he raised from the dead. There they made him a supper; and Martha served: but Lazarus was one of them that sat at the table with him. Then took Mary a pound of ointment of spikenard, very costly, and anointed the feet of Jesus, and wiped his feet with her hair: and the house was filled with the odour of the ointment. Then saith one of his disciples, Judas Iscariot, Simon’s son, which should betray him, Why was not this ointment sold for three hundred pence, and given to the poor? This he said, not that he cared for the poor; but because he was a thief, and had the bag, and bare what was put therein. Then said Jesus, Let her alone: against the day of my burying hath she kept this. For the poor always ye have with you; but me ye have not always. John 12:1-8
